ANU International Research Scholarships Details

Comprehensive Benefits

The ANU International Research Scholarships for the academic year 2024-25 offer a comprehensive range of benefits, including:

  • Full tuition fee coverage
  • Monthly stipend for living expenses
  • Airfare tickets for relocation
  • Thesis and course materials allowance
  • Overseas Student Health Cover (OSHC)

Deadline

  • Round 1 International: Applications close on August 31 each year. The commencement year for successful applicants is the following year by March 31.
  • Round 1 Domestic: Applications close on October 31 each year. The commencement year for successful applicants is the following year by March 31.
  • Round 2 International and Domestic: Applications close on April 15 each year. The commencement year for successful applicants is the same year by August 31.
